GPHG 2012: Grand Prix d’Horlogerie de Genève

GPHG 2012

70 is the number of watches shortlisted for the Grand Prix d’Horlogerie de Genève 2012 (GPHG).

The 12th awards ceremony will be held at Geneva’s Grand Théâtre on 15 November 2012.

As every year, the watches in competition will take part in a travelling exhibition. First stop: Zurich, at Les Ambassadeurs on Bahnhofstrasse, then on to Hong Kong and Shanghai.

The final stage at Geneva’s Cité du Temps will give the public the chance to discover the 70 timepieces from 2 to 8 November 2012.

The GHPG 2011 saw the following watches triumph:

 

De Bethune DB28DB28, De Bethune, Aiguille d’Or Prize

 

Audemars Piguet Millenary 4101Millenary 4101, Audemars Piguet, Public Prize

 

Hermes Arceau Le Temps SuspenduLe Temps Suspendu, Hermès, Men’s Watch Prize

 

Boucheron Hathi Crazy JungleCrazy Jungle “Hathi”, Boucheron, Ladies’ Watch Prize

 

Zenith Academy Christophe Colomb Equation du TempsAcademy Christophe Colomb Equation of Time, Zenith, Grand Complication Prize

 

Van Cleef Arpels Lady Arpels Paysage Polaire PhoqueLady Arpels Polar Landscape Seal Deco,Van Cleef & Arpels, Jewellery Watch and Métiers d’Art Prize

 

Tag Heuer Mikrotimer Flying 1000 ChronographeMikrotimer Flying 1000, Tag Heuer, Sports Watch Prize

 

Urwerk UR-110 TitaniumUR110 Titanium, Urwerk, Design Watch Prize

 

Montblanc Star Worldtime GMT AutomaticStar WorldTime GMT Automatic, Montblanc, Petite Aiguille Prize
